WebThe Civil Rights Movement racked up many notable victories, from the dismantling of Jim Crow segregation in the South, to the passage of federal legislation outlawing racial discrimination, to the widespread awareness of the African American cultural heritage and its unique contributions to the history of the United States. Web3 OCR 2024 Y319/01 un19 SECTION B Answer TWO of the following three questions. 2* ‘The quality of African American leadership was the most important factor in the advancement of African American civil rights in the period from 1865 to 1992.’ How far do you agree?
